Subaru Outback (BR): Audio set

Your SUBARU may be equipped with one of the following audio sets. See the pages indicated in this section for operating details.

NOTE

If a cell phone is placed near the audio set, it may cause the audio set to emit noise when the phone receives calls. This noise does not indicate an audio set malfunction. Note that a cell phone should be placed as far as possible from the audio set.
